Output dfd4fc0a3f4e77d84267fdf8f826020af28077586f9d7f6186e8ad9cbb2ebda9:51

value
238080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b4880480a2a2e752ad2ce66ad2d69efe0e1585 OP_EQUAL
address
31r2sGhce3fNMsBAyu8NSNBDmf1ZbyTk5d
transaction
dfd4fc0a3f4e77d84267fdf8f826020af28077586f9d7f6186e8ad9cbb2ebda9
confirmations
179855
spent
true